Assessing Your Home's Solar Possible



Prior to diving into solar panel installment, you should examine your home's solar possibility. Beginning by examining your roof's alignment and slope; south-facing roofing systems generally capture the most sunshine.



Look for any blockages, like trees or high structures, that could cast shadows on your panels. These can significantly reduce energy production. Consider your regional environment as well; sunny locations yield much better results than constantly over cast regions.

Next, review your power demands and usage patterns to identify the number of panels you'll need. You may likewise intend to utilize on the internet solar calculators or talk to a professional to obtain a clearer picture.

Evaluating Your Energy Needs and Consumption



Just how can you identify the right solar panel system for your home? Beginning by assessing your power requirements and consumption.

Look at your energy costs over the past year to understand your average monthly use. This'll offer you a baseline for just how much energy you require to create. Do not forget to take into consideration seasonal variations; your power needs may spike in summer season or winter season.

Next, think about any type of future adjustments, like adding devices or electric cars, which can raise your intake.

Exploring Financial Rewards and Tax Debts



Before you dedicate to setting up solar panels, it's necessary to explore the economic motivations and tax credits available to you. Federal and state federal governments usually give considerable tax obligation credit histories to counter installation prices.

For instance, the government solar tax obligation debt can cover a percentage of your expenses, permitting you to save thousands. Additionally, many states provide discounts or grants to encourage solar fostering, which can additionally lower your preliminary investment.

Utility companies may also have incentive programs that compensate you for producing solar power. Study these alternatives thoroughly and seek advice from a tax obligation expert to maximize your savings.

Panel Performance Ratings



As you discover the globe of solar panels, recognizing panel effectiveness ratings is vital for making a notified decision. These ratings suggest how properly a panel converts sunshine right into functional electricity. The higher the performance, the a lot more energy you'll create from a smaller sized space. The majority of residential panels vary from 15% to 22% effectiveness.

When choosing your panels, consider your energy needs and readily available roofing room. If you have restricted space, selecting higher-efficiency panels could be useful. Nonetheless, if you have enough roof covering location, lower-efficiency panels may be sufficient.

Visual Considerations



While functionality is crucial, aesthetic appeals shouldn't be neglected when picking solar panels for your home. You want panels that not only work properly but also match your home's design.

Consider the shade and size of the solar panels; black panels frequently blend flawlessly with dark roofings, while blue panels could attract attention more. Look into alternatives like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that change traditional roof products, using a smooth look.

You could additionally check out solar shingles, which resemble common roof and can enhance curb allure. Don't forget to analyze the design and placement of the panels to optimize both performance and aesthetic harmony.

Ultimately, striking the best balance in between performance and aesthetic appeals will make your solar investment a lot more fulfilling.

Preparation for Upkeep and Long-term Efficiency



Choosing a trusted solar installer sets the structure for your solar panel system, however preparing for maintenance and lasting efficiency is equally as important.

Routine maintenance can expand the life of your solar panels and ensure they operate at peak performance. Consider organizing annual evaluations to check for debris, damages, or use.

Likewise, familiarize on your own with the warranty and service arrangements; knowing what's covered can conserve you money down the line. Keep an eye on your power production, as an unexpected drop might show a problem.

Ultimately, stay educated regarding technical innovations; updating elements can improve efficiency and effectiveness, ultimately optimizing your investment in solar power.
